HELENA – A spokeswoman with the Department of Public Health and Human Services says there have been no cases of swine flu confirmed in Montana.
Bonnie Barnard, supervisor of the Communicable Disease and Epidemiology Section, said Thursday that more than 100 samples have been tested, with none showing positive for the H1N1 flu virus.
She says they are still seeing seasonal influenza. Those who are sick are advised to cover their coughs, wash their hands and stay home from work, school, day care or large gatherings if you have flu-like symptoms.
